  • What are Old Ben and the Giant Sycamore Stump?
    • Old Ben, the “World's Largest Steer,” and the Giant Sycamore Stump are two unique attractions in the city of Kokomo, Indiana.
  • How big was Old Ben?
    • At birth, Old Ben weighed 125 pounds in 1902, and when he died in 1910, he weighed between 4,585 and 4,720 pounds.
  • Where can Old Ben be found today?
    • In 1968, Old Ben was featured in Ripley’s “Believe It or Not” and can now be found in a pavilion within Highland Park.
  • What is the Giant Sycamore Stump?
    • The Giant Sycamore Stump, also located in the same pavilion, measures fifty-seven feet in diameter.
  • How was the Giant Sycamore Stump used in the past?
    • The landmark was once used as a massive phone booth.
